BREAKING: Terrorists Abduct Over 50 Students From St. Mary’s School In Niger

Terrorists have reportedly abducted over 50 students from St. Mary’s School, a Catholic institution located in Papiri community, Agwara Local Government Area of Niger State.

The incident has caused widespread concern among parents and the local community.

The abduction took place during a violent raid on the school. Witnesses reported that armed men stormed the school premises and forcefully took the students. The exact number of students affected is still being verified.

The Niger State Government has officially confirmed the development in a statement. Authorities said they are closely monitoring the situation and working with security agencies to ensure the safe return of the pupils.

In its statement, the Niger State Government expressed deep sadness over the incident, describing the kidnapping as disturbing and unacceptable. The government reassured the public that all necessary measures are being taken to address the situation.

Parents and community members have expressed anxiety over the safety of children in schools across the state, urging the government to strengthen security in educational institutions. The incident has raised concerns about the vulnerability of schools to attacks in the region.

Security agencies are expected to intensify their efforts to rescue the abducted students and prevent future attacks. The state government has appealed to residents and stakeholders to remain calm and cooperate with authorities in the ongoing response.
